A few days ago, the Ministry of Industry and Information Technology, the Ministry of Science and Technology, the Ministry of Finance, and the Civil Aviation Administration of China jointly issued the "Implementation Plan for the Innovative Application of General Aviation Equipment (2024-2030)", proposing to encourage the research and development of flying car technology, product verification and exploration of commercial application scenarios; By 2030, general aviation equipment will be fully integrated into all fields of people's production and life, becoming a powerful driving force for low-altitude economic growth and forming a trillion-yuan market scale.

Flying cars are an important carrier of the low-altitude economy. While the policy is gradually advancing, related enterprises are also vying to lay out the production of flying cars. On March 8, Xpeng Huitian's "Voyager X2" flying car successfully completed the low-altitude flight in the "Tiande Plaza-Canton Tower" area of Guangzhou CBD; On the same day, GAC Group's flying car GOVE also carried out a flight demonstration over Guangzhou CBD. On March 25, Xpeng Huitian announced that the flying body (code: X3-F) of its "Land Aircraft Carrier" flying car will soon enter the airworthiness certification stage. According to the plan, the Xpeng Huitian split flying car will be available for pre-order in the fourth quarter of this year, and it is planned to start mass production and delivery in the fourth quarter of 2025. GAC Group's "GAC GOVE" multi-rotor configuration flying car successfully made its world first flight in June last year, and has completed more than 300 flight tests. The "GAC GOVE" composite wing configuration flying car under development can meet the needs of 150 kilometers of intercity travel in the Guangdong-Hong Kong-Macao Greater Bay Area in the future. According to the plan, GAC will start demonstration operation of flying cars in 2025, and realize three-dimensional travel scenarios based on "all-space unmanned systems" in two to three cities in the Bay Area in 2027.

In addition to Xiaopeng and GAC, in recent years, Geely, Volkswagen and other car companies have also rushed to enter the game, and a number of flying cars have been released one after another. EHang's two unmanned manned aircraft have even been launched on Taobao. Driven by policy and technology, the dream of flying cars is becoming a reality.

Since the invention of automobiles and airplanes, mankind has been exploring flying cars for 100 years. Today, the flying car industry, represented by eVTOL (electric vertical take-off and landing aircraft), is booming around the world. According to incomplete statistics, including aviation giants such as Boeing and Airbus, automobile companies such as Volkswagen and Toyota, as well as some start-up companies, there are more than 200 flying car projects under development around the world, and more than 160 companies are trying to build flying cars.

In the Chinese market, in the fourth quarter of 2023, EHang's EH216-S unmanned manned aircraft successively obtained the Type Certificate (TC) and Standard Airworthiness Certificate (AC) issued by the Civil Aviation Administration of China, becoming the world's first unmanned manned eVTOL to obtain the airworthiness certificate. With the acquisition of "double certificates", the market demand for EH216-S has surged. According to EHang's financial report, a total of 52 EH216 series products will be delivered in 2023, doubling from 21 in 2022.

Wang Tan, co-founder and vice president of Xpeng Huitian and general manager of Xpeng Motors Styling Center, said that the future of travel will be intelligently connected, electrified and sustainable energy, but more importantly, three-dimensional. At present, the global flying car industry is still in its infancy, and the future will be a blue ocean. In contrast, foreign flying cars started earlier, but Chinese companies rely on the leading advantages of smart electric vehicles to take the lead in many product research and development and technology, and the commercial application of flying cars in the future will also be ahead.

The relevant person in charge of GAC Group believes that the development of the automobile industry has brought a new technological revolution and industrial transformation to the commercial aviation field. The core components of flying cars, which account for 60% of the cost, are consistent with the technical direction of electric vehicles, and the automotive industry chain provides the possibility for the large-scale and low-cost development of aircraft, and ground transportation has a strong demand for the development of three-dimensional transportation.

Technological breakthroughs require policy support. In February 2021, the low-altitude economy was written into the "National Comprehensive Three-dimensional Transportation Network Planning Outline" for the first time; In December last year, the Central Economic Work Conference established the low-altitude economy as a national strategic emerging industry; At this year's National People's Congress and the National People's Congress, the low-altitude economy was written into the "Government Work Report" for the first time.

The Civil Aviation Administration of China predicts that the market size of the mainland's low-altitude economy will reach 1.5 trillion yuan by 2025 and 3.5 trillion yuan by 2035. Kaiyuan Securities believes that the policy industry resonance in 2024 is expected to become the first year of the low-altitude economy, and the opening of subsequent manned passenger market application scenarios is expected to speed up the eVTOL market.

As for the overall market size of flying cars, consulting firm Roland Berger expects the number of eVTOLs in commercial operation worldwide to reach 5,000 by 2030 and 160,000 by 2050. Morgan Stanley predicts that by 2050, the global market size accessible to urban passenger transport will reach US$9 trillion, and the potential market size of China will reach US$2.1 trillion.

Cui Dongshu, secretary general of the National Passenger Car Market Information Association, said that flying cars, as an important application field of low-altitude economy, will play an effective role in supplementing the overall travel. At present, the use of flying cars is still based on specific scenarios, and there are still breakthroughs to be made in product safety and cruising range in the future.

The relevant person in charge of GAC Group said that from the current development trend of flying cars and the predictions of all parties, the commercialization of flying cars will come faster than the public expects, and the commercialization boom will be set off in the next 5 to 10 years, but the operation of the product is still carried out in a restricted environment, and the safety has not yet been fully verified by the market and recognized by the public.

Some industry experts believe that the application scenarios of flying cars are mainly affected by two aspects: one is the technical boundary of the product, including power, safety, etc.; The second is policies and regulations, such as airspace management, flight standards, etc. The application scenarios of flying cars will change with the changes of both. In the early stage, flying car products had limited flight speed, distance and flyable airspace, and mainly flew in limited scenarios with fixed routes. With the increase of range and speed, and the further opening of airspace, some fixed flight grids will be formed in the city, which can realize short-distance travel within the city, and intercity transportation between some urban agglomerations will also become a high-frequency application scenario.

Wang Tan said that in the long run, as the products and air traffic management become more and more mature, door-to-door, end-to-end commuting within the city will be realized, and a complete three-dimensional transportation network will be established. (Economic Times)
